Navigating the September Slowdown: How to Reset and Rebalance Your Life

Young woman in water enjoying September Slowdown by a lake.

Embrace the September Slowdown: Finding Balance After the Buzz of Summer

As we wave goodbye to the long summer days filled with barbecues, trips, and non-stop activity, many people feel the weight of exhaustion as September approaches. While we often think summer is a time for relaxation and rejuvenation, the reality is that our packed calendars can leave us feeling drained rather than refreshed. For those of us in Castle Rock, this is the perfect season to explore ways to rebalance our lives and find harmony amidst the hustle. Understanding this transition is crucial, especially as we navigate back-to-school chaos and shifting routines.

The Consequences of Constant Activity

Stephanie Davis, a certified organizational coach from Fort Langley, BC, highlights an important truth: our busy summer schedules can lead to a sense of unpredictability that wears down our nervous systems. Travel plans, family duties, and social commitments during the warmer months, while enjoyable, often bring stress and overstimulation. Instead of feeling poised and ready for a new season, many are left feeling depleted as the back-to-school routines kick in. It’s not uncommon to feel overwhelmed; the expectations we place on ourselves can amplify the stress.

Understanding the Stress Response

Our nervous system operates like a control center, balancing two cores: the sympathetic and parasympathetic systems. The sympathetic nervous system triggers our fight-or-flight response, which, interestingly, can be activated by stressors even in seemingly joyful situations like summer parties or vacations. According to Davis, the impact of jet lag and unpredictable sleep patterns during the summer causes a spike in cortisol, the stress hormone, affecting our overall mood and health. This understanding is crucial for those in Castle Rock, where the lifestyle often encourages constant engagement and activity.

Signs Your Nervous System Needs a Reset

When our nervous system becomes overstimulated, we can experience various signs of dysregulation including irritability, headaches, and difficulty sleeping. Briana Takeshita from the Luna Health Clinic cautions that long-term exposure to this state can lead to serious health concerns such as anxiety, depression, or even cardiovascular issues. Recognizing your body's signals is crucial; common indicators can help you identify when it's time to slow down. For instance, if you notice persistent fatigue or irritability, these can be red flags urging you to take a step back and reassess your well-being.

September: An Invitation to Reset

As the temperature begins to cool, September beckons us to welcome change. The transition into fall provides a unique opportunity to harness the power of our parasympathetic nervous system, fostering rest and recovery. Finding moments to relax and reconnect with ourselves can steer us away from the hectic pace of summer and embrace a more mindful, balanced lifestyle. This reshaping of priorities is vital, especially in a community like Castle Rock, where outdoor activities and social engagements can dominate our schedules.

Actionable Tips for Rebalancing

1. **Schedule Time for Yourself**: Prioritize alone time, whether it's soaking in a warm bath, reading your favorite book, or engaging in yoga. Designating dedicated 'me time' helps foster a sense of peace and restoration. Consider creating a weekly ritual, such as a Sunday morning where you enjoy a leisurely coffee while planning a more balanced week ahead.

2. **Set Realistic Goals**: As you move into the busyness of fall, set practical goals for your daily life. Simplifying your commitments can alleviate the pressure and allow you to engage fully in what brings you joy. This could mean choosing fewer activities on weekends or allowing for more downtime after work, crucial for mental clarity.

3. **Practice Mindfulness**: Techniques like deep breathing or guided meditation can act as anchors during turbulent times, enabling you to cultivate stillness amidst the chaos of life. You might explore local classes on mindfulness or find online resources that resonate with you. Even a five-minute daily practice can lead to noticeable improvements in your overall peace of mind.

Master the Art of Boiling Potatoes: Timing and Techniques You Need

Update The Essential Guide to Boiling Potatoes Just Right Boiling potatoes may seem straightforward, yet nailing that perfect texture can elevate your cooking dramatically. Whether you're making a classic potato salad or creamy mashed potatoes, the key lies in two critical factors: time and salt. Let’s dive deeper into the steps to achieve perfectly boiled potatoes every time, along with some pro tips to make them shine in any dish. Understanding the Boiling Process To achieve evenly cooked potatoes, it’s vital to start them in cold, salted water. This helps the potatoes cook uniformly from the outside in. When placed directly into boiling water, the outer layer cooks too quickly, leaving the inside hard and undercooked. Salt is crucial, too—using a generous amount seasons the potatoes throughout, creating a deeper flavor profile. How Long to Boil Different Types of Potatoes The boiling time for potatoes varies significantly based on their size and shape. Small potatoes, like baby or fingerling, typically take only 8 to 12 minutes to become tender. In contrast, larger chunks for mashed potatoes can require up to 30 minutes or more. Here’s a quick guide: Baby Potatoes: 8–12 minutes for tender, flavorful results. Medium Potatoes: Check at 18–22 minutes, ensuring they’re tender for salads and sides. Large Potatoes (cut into cubes): Expect 20–30 minutes for perfect mashing. How to Test if Your Potatoes are Done Don’t rely solely on a timer; test your potatoes for doneness by using a fork. Fork-tender is the gold standard, meaning a fork should slide easily into the potato's center. For mashed potatoes, they should be particularly soft, giving way instantly to a knife. Common Mistakes When Boiling Potatoes 1. Not Using Enough Salt: Potatoes absorb water and flavors during cooking, so insufficient salt leads to bland results. Aim for at least a cup of salt per three quarts of water for effective seasoning. 2. Overcrowding the Pot: Placing too many potatoes can lead to uneven cooking. Work in batches if necessary to ensure each potato is surrounded by plenty of water. 3. Skipping the Soak: Give your peeled potatoes a quick rinse before boiling to remove excess starch, which can lead to a gummy texture. Elevating Your Boiled Potatoes Once boiled, consider how to enhance your spuds further. For something special, mash them with butter and cream. Or, for a deliciously different take, roast the boiled potatoes in olive oil and your favorite herbs for crispy edges and fluffy centers. Mastering the Art of Boiling Potatoes: Tips for Perfect Flavor

Update Unlocking the Perfect Boiled Potatoes: A Culinary Guide Boiling potatoes may seem like a simple task, yet a few nuances can make all the difference between a delicious side and a mushy mess. Understanding the essentials—timing, water temperature, and seasoning—can enhance the way you cook. The Essential Timing Formula for Boiled Potatoes The key factor to consider when boiling potatoes is their size and type. Smaller potatoes can cook in less than 15 minutes, while larger chunks, ideal for mashed potatoes or soup, may take up to 40 minutes. For instance, baby potatoes are beautifully tender after about 8-12 minutes, while medium potatoes and their larger cousins require significantly more time—around 18-25 and 30-40 minutes, respectively. Discover the Secret: Salting Your Potatoes One pivotal piece of advice is to add ample salt to your boiling water. Begin with 1 cup of Diamond Crystal kosher salt for every 3 quarts of water. While most of this salt will drain away with the cooking water, it infuses the potatoes with flavor during the cooking process. This simple step ensures that the potatoes are seasoned to perfection. The Art of Cooking: Cold Water Vs. Boiling Water Here’s a common mistake: adding potatoes to already boiling water. Instead, start your potatoes in cold water to enable even cooking throughout. This approach allows the outsides and insides to heat at the same time, resulting in a tender and fluffy texture. Always remember to check for "fork-tenderness" before removing them from the heat. Culinary Uses: What's Your Potato Goal? The type and preparation of your boiled potatoes will determine cooking time: Smashed Potatoes: 8-12 minutes for fingerling or baby potatoes. Potato Salad: 15-20 minutes for small to medium potatoes, cut into even pieces. Mashed Potatoes: 20-25 minutes for large cubes of russet potatoes, which should be cut beforehand to ensure even cooking. Gnocchi: 35-40 minutes for very large pieces, allowing them ample time to soften. Keep in mind, these cooking times should be seen as a gentle guideline rather than strict rules. Every kitchen is different, and factors such as altitude can affect boil times. Myth-Busting: Misconceptions About Boiling Potatoes A common misconception exists that all you need to do is boil potatoes until they are soft. In truth, the texture you’re aiming for varies with the dish you’re preparing. For instance, if you plan to make a creamy potato salad, ensure they are not overcooked, as they'll turn mushy upon dressing. Conversely, for mashed potatoes, you want them soft enough to whip into a smooth consistency. Embracing the Potato: Emotional Connections Potatoes are often seen as humble ingredients, yet they have the power to evoke memories and stimulate taste bud nostalgia. Boiling them just right can transform any dish, from a comforting family dinner to a celebratory feast. It’s not merely about the food enjoyed but the stories and gatherings shared around it. Getting It Just Right: A Step-by-Step Process 1. Start with cold water and thoroughly scrub your potatoes. 2. Add a robust measure of salt to infuse flavor. 3. Place them on the stove and gradually bring to a boil. 4. Reduce the heat to a gentle simmer and keep an eye on your potatoes as they cook. 5. Test for doneness by pricking with a fork, ensuring they’re tender enough for your dish. Revitalize Your Life: Recharge Your Social Battery for Better Well-being

Update Understanding Your "Social Battery" and Its Impact on Well-Being In today's fast-paced world, the term "social battery" has gained traction to describe our everyday energy levels in social situations. Much like a phone that needs charging, our social battery can become drained after prolonged interactions with others. This phenomenon is especially relevant for adults in Castle Rock, who seek to maintain their mental well-being amidst busy lives and social obligations. The concept underscores the need to recognize not just when we feel overwhelmed, but also to appreciate the moments when our social interactions boost our spirits. The Balance of Social Engagement and Personal Recharge Human connection is vital for mental health, yet actively engaging with others can take a toll. Everyone has different thresholds for social interaction. For some, a crowded weekend can be invigorating, while others may find it exhausting. Recognizing when our social battery is low can help us take proactive steps to recharge. Consider spending a quiet evening reading a book or enjoying a peaceful walk in one of Castle Rock's scenic parks to rejuvenate. It’s important to remember that social energy is not solely about the number of interactions but also the quality of those connections. Engaging with close friends or loved ones often replenishes our energy more than casual acquaintances or large gatherings. Why Do We Feel Strained After Social Events? Several reasons contribute to feeling drained after social gatherings. Factors such as stress, social anxiety, and personal expectations can heavily influence how we react during and after interactions. Understanding these feelings can empower us to manage our social lives more effectively. For instance, if you leave a social event feeling exhausted, it doesn’t necessarily mean you’re unsociable; it may simply indicate that you need to recharge your social battery. Recognizing these signals can help foster a more compassionate relationship with ourselves, allowing us to embrace our individuality without judgment. Finding the Right Balance: Tips for a Healthy Social Life Maintaining a balanced social life is essential for emotional health. Here are a few practical tips to keep in mind: Set Boundaries: Know your limits regarding social engagements. It’s perfectly acceptable to decline invitations if you feel overwhelmed. Prioritize your mental health over social obligations. Prioritize Quality Over Quantity: Engage more deeply with fewer people instead of spreading yourself too thin across various activities. Nurturing close friendships can provide a stronger support system. Incorporate Downtime: Schedule regular breaks in your week to recharge. Whether through meditation, yoga, or nature walks, find activities that leave you feeling refreshed and re-energized. Practice Mindfulness: Engage in mindfulness practices that help ground you before and after social interactions. This can help reduce feelings of anxiety and help you become more present, enhancing your enjoyment.
